    RedHat 7.2 Install over Network

    Here is the scenario:

    I have a machine running 7.2 that I would like to use to install to another one over the network. The machine receiving the installation would have a few thigns different, such as lacking a floppy or cdrom drive. I would like to know if it is possible to install linux in this way, and I can't put a floppy or cdrom drive in because it is a bare bones machine designed to be a server.

    can you borrow one to get the install on the roll?

    otherwise your gonna have to remove the hd, put it in another computer and put the boot files you need on it

    It is prefectly possible to install over the network (have not done it with red hat tho) but you still need to boot the machine and tell it where to look for the install
